Posted: 03/25/07 - 11:34 Post subject: Stomach distended and hard post liposuction |
|
|
| I had abdominal tumescent liposuction 2 weeks ago. All is healing well except I consistently have a hard distended lower belly. The top portion of my stomach, my waistline and love handles are fine but this feels wierd. It's swollen at the panty line and above my pubic bone. It's so puffy there. Tender like the compression girdle (adjustable) has pressed it down and squished any fluid down there. The bruising is going away, but it had spread like syrup over pancakes down beneath my pelvis into the upper thighs. Is this normal? It's not really overly painful but could the surgeon have knicked me inside and that's why this is happening? It doesn't ever go flat yet. always rounded and distended and hard at the bottom above my pelvis. |

| I am 1 month post lipo and I am thrilled with the results, dr took off almost 3 liters of fat and I feel like a new woman, I do have pockets of hard areas that go away after massaging them. I have found that a massage ball that I got at bath and body works, is the best for massaging areas, you can acutally feel the fluid leaving the area, the ball helps distribute the pressure and it hurts less than when you use your hands. |

Almost 7 weeks post lipo on inner thighs and tummy/handles.
I have gained a few kilos due to not exercising and just general inactivity & snacking while avoiding going out (had rhinoplasty too).
I tried on a pair of pants the other day that were loose just after the op. They now fit me again. I think natural fluids return to the area -- immediately after the op you are all "drained" and compressed and inevitably your natural shape returns somewhat.
I can see where the fat has gone, so am happy.
Some lumpy spots in thighs and belly button looks a bit odd now (smaller) but overall am pleased.
Moral: it really isn't weight that counts, it's fitness and inches.
Cheer up, esp. if you have quite a lot done, your body needs time to recover. There's definitely 3 litres less fat there, remember ! |
